GO Term : GO:0007066 female meiosis sister chromatid cohesion GO

Namespace:  biological_process Obsolete:  false
description  The joining of the sister chromatids of a replicated chromosome along the entire length of the chromosome that occurs during meiosis in a female.

Identifier Name Description
GO:0007049 cell cycle The progression of biochemical and morphological phases and events that occur in a cell during successive cell replication or nuclear replication events. Canonically, the cell cycle comprises the replication and segregation of genetic material followed by the division of the cell, but in endocycles or syncytial cells nuclear replication or nuclear division may not be followed by cell division.
GO:0051276 chromosome organization A process that is carried out at the cellular level that results in the assembly, arrangement of constituent parts, or disassembly of chromosomes, structures composed of a very long molecule of DNA and associated proteins that carries hereditary information. This term covers covalent modifications at the molecular level as well as spatial relationships among the major components of a chromosome.
GO:0051321 meiotic cell cycle Progression through the phases of the meiotic cell cycle, in which canonically a cell replicates to produce four offspring with half the chromosomal content of the progenitor cell via two nuclear divisions.
GO:0007059 chromosome segregation The process in which genetic material, in the form of chromosomes, is organized into specific structures and then physically separated and apportioned to two or more sets. In eukaryotes, chromosome segregation begins with the condensation of chromosomes, includes chromosome separation, and ends when chromosomes have completed movement to the spindle poles.
GO:0045132 meiotic chromosome segregation The process in which genetic material, in the form of chromosomes, is organized into specific structures and then physically separated and apportioned to two or more sets during M phase of the meiotic cell cycle.
GO:0016043 cellular component organization A process that results in the assembly, arrangement of constituent parts, or disassembly of a cellular component.
GO:0009987 cellular process Any process that is carried out at the cellular level, but not necessarily restricted to a single cell. For example, cell communication occurs among more than one cell, but occurs at the cellular level.
GO:0007126 meiotic nuclear division One of the two nuclear divisions that occur as part of the meiotic cell cycle.
GO:0007062 sister chromatid cohesion The cell cycle process in which the sister chromatids of a replicated chromosome are associated with each other.
GO:0006996 organelle organization A process that is carried out at the cellular level which results in the assembly, arrangement of constituent parts, or disassembly of an organelle within a cell. An organelle is an organized structure of distinctive morphology and function. Includes the nucleus, mitochondria, plastids, vacuoles, vesicles, ribosomes and the cytoskeleton. Excludes the plasma membrane.
GO:0007143 female meiotic division A cell cycle process by which the cell nucleus divides as part of a meiotic cell cycle in the female germline.
GO:0070192 chromosome organization involved in meiotic cell cycle A process of chromosome organization that is involved in a meiotic cell cycle.
GO:0044763 single-organism cellular process Any process that is carried out at the cellular level, occurring within a single organism.
GO:0044699 single-organism process A biological process that involves only one organism.
GO:0071840 cellular component organization or biogenesis A process that results in the biosynthesis of constituent macromolecules, assembly, arrangement of constituent parts, or disassembly of a cellular component.
GO:1902589 single-organism organelle organization An organelle organization which involves only one organism.
GO:0008150 biological_process Any process specifically pertinent to the functioning of integrated living units: cells, tissues, organs, and organisms. A process is a collection of molecular events with a defined beginning and end.
GO:0000003 reproduction The production of new individuals that contain some portion of genetic material inherited from one or more parent organisms.
GO:0022402 cell cycle process The cellular process that ensures successive accurate and complete genome replication and chromosome segregation.
GO:0000819 sister chromatid segregation The cell cycle process in which sister chromatids are organized and then physically separated and apportioned to two or more sets.
GO:0098813 nuclear chromosome segregation The process in which genetic material, in the form of nuclear chromosomes, is organized into specific structures and then physically separated and apportioned to two or more sets. Nuclear chromosome segregation begins with the condensation of chromosomes, includes chromosome separation, and ends when chromosomes have completed movement to the spindle poles.
GO:0048285 organelle fission The creation of two or more organelles by division of one organelle.
GO:0000280 nuclear division The division of a cell nucleus into two nuclei, with DNA and other nuclear contents distributed between the daughter nuclei.
GO:1903046 meiotic cell cycle process A process that is part of the meiotic cell cycle.
GO:0022414 reproductive process A biological process that directly contributes to the process of producing new individuals by one or two organisms. The new individuals inherit some proportion of their genetic material from the parent or parents.
GO:0044702 single organism reproductive process A biological process that directly contributes to the process of producing new individuals, involving a single organism.
GO:0007135 meiosis II The second nuclear division of meiosis, in which the two chromatids in each chromosome are separated, resulting in four daughter nuclei from the two nuclei produced in meiosis II.
GO:0051177 meiotic sister chromatid cohesion The cell cycle process in which sister chromatids of a replicated chromosome are joined along the entire length of the chromosome during meiosis.
GO:0045144 meiotic sister chromatid segregation The cell cycle process in which sister chromatids are organized and then physically separated and randomly apportioned to two sets during the second division of the meiotic cell cycle.
